Flying Power
Canadian Company Magenn Power has tested a new device that does not resemble conventional windmills. This device is a hybrid of balloon and water mill. Inflatable turbine with helium inside can climb to a height of several tens of meters, and unwinding a flow of air to generate electricity.
A container filled with helium, is bent at an angle of the blade, very similar to the wheel of the watermill. The air flow acts on them as well as a stream of water on the wheel, and air construction begins slowly rotate.
Generator power flying shortcomings inherent in existing designs of impeller power, for example, it does not emit infrasound and does not harm the bird's propeller blades. Denial of expensive masts is another advantage of this wind turbine.
Wind turbine called Magenn Power Air Rotor System (MARS) and completed its first successful test in the U.S. state of North Carolina .
Installation and operation of the new device is much easier than terrestrial wind. To set a flying wind turbine requires only a small foundation with a winch and transformer station. With the help of ropes device rises to a height of 300 m , where the flow velocity can reach 100 km / h. In the case of a threat of hurricane can pull the balloon to the ground and hide in the hangar.
For comparison, the existing mast, wind turbines can not work with gusty winds over 60 km / h, because their blades are in resonance, the load grows and the structure collapses.
However, these wind farms have restrictions on use. Thus, these windmills will be able to work only in countries with warm climates, at zero temperature and strong winds balloon begins cover by ice and break down the elements of design. In addition to construction, continuous monitoring of staff, in contrast to the mast windmills. Such objects are very unstable behavior in the air. In good weather, everything is normal. But in other circumstances may cause difficulties in the proper orientation. Because reactance wind, they can ill-spun, turbulent flows are beginning to shake the balloon, resulting in system efficiency decreases.
